Brief Summary

The rationale for this study is that GLP-1 agonist treatment is likely to influence myocardial substrate utilisation, changing the predominant source of metabolic energy within the heart to a more energetically efficient form. This is represented by a surrogate for improved mitochondrial efficiency with reduction in myocardial lactate levels (produced by inefficient myocardial glycolysis, prevalent in the ventricles of patients with pulmonary hypertension), which can be measured by 31P-magnetic resonance spectroscopy (31P-MRS).

You may qualify if:

  • \- 1. Diagnosis of Group 1 PAH confirmed by right heart catheterisation under the National Pulmonary Hypertension Service, Royal Brompton Hospital, part of GSTT Foundation Trust 2. Age over 18, less than 85 years 3. Able to give informed consent 4. On a stable dose of PAH-specific therapies (e.g., ERA, PDE5i) for at least 3 months.
  • \. Clinically justified prescription of GLP-1 agonist Semaglutide based on following criteria: BMI \> 30 or BMI \> 27 with at least one cardiovascular co-morbidity (systemic hypertension, diabetes, pre-diabetes, COPD, atrial fibrillation, dyslipidaemia, sleep disordered breathing)

You may not qualify if:

  • 1. Pregnancy
  • \. Myocardial infarction within the previous 3 months
  • \. Contraindications to MRI: Pacemakers, metallic implants, or severe claustrophobia.
  • \. Severe renal impairment: eGFR \< 15ml/min/1.73m.
  • \. Current use of SGLT2 inhibitors or GLP-1 agonist therapy (which significantly alter fuel substrate preference) or insulin therapy that cannot be held for the fasting scan
